Overview

The Grammar of Present Day English is a comprehensive guide to the grammar and syntax of the English language, written by Carl Holliday in 1919. The book covers a wide range of topics, including parts of speech, sentence structure, punctuation, and the use of idiomatic expressions. It provides clear explanations and examples of each topic, making it a valuable resource for students, teachers, and anyone interested in improving their understanding of English grammar. The book is written in a straightforward and accessible style, making it easy to understand and apply the information presented. Despite being over a century old, The Grammar of Present Day English remains a relevant and useful guide to the English language.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
